Illinois

Sufjan Stevens
Illinois

Asthmatic Kitty


This album is one of the most refreshing pieces of music to have been released in years. Sufjan Stevens attempts to do something unique and remarkably, he succeeds while still producing music that is addictively catchy. An incredible ensemble of instruments that rage from church organ to saxophone are all wielded by Stevens to create a rich, complex sound. The album, Illinois, is an ode to the state of Illinois and features 22 tracks that all focus on the history of the state. Normally this might sound really strange, but Stevens pulls it together in such a way that it doesn’t alienate listeners outside the Illinois state line. The lyrics are very well written and most of the songs have a universal appeal. The added highlight is the detailed cover art which features a painting of the Chicago skyline with Superman and Al Capone. The album has a very melancholy feel with a saddening element constantly being counteracted by a hopeful presence. Released early this month (July), the album is already a big hit with the indie rock community and has been lauded with praise by print media and the blogosphere alike.
